  • April 1: Dr. James Kasting - How to Find a Habitable Planet. Over 400 planets have been found around nearby stars, but none of them is thought to be at all like Earth. Within the next two decades, though, astronomers hope to identify Earth-like planets around nearby stars and to search their atmospheres spectroscopically for signs of life. The presence of O2, which is produced from photosynthesis, or O3, which is produced photochemically from O2, would under most circumstances provide strong evidence for life beyond Earth. Different techniques for planet-finding, and possible alternative biosignatures, will be discussed. I will also contrast my optimism about the search for complex life with the more pessimistic view expressed by Ward and Brownlee in their book, Rare Earth.   South Hills School of Bus. & Tech..
